Silver halide photosensitive materials containing thiourea and analogue derivatives

A photographic silver halide emulsion comprising a 1,1,3,3-tetrasubstituted middle chalcogen urea compound is described wherein at least one substituent comprises an acid function. The urea compound is an effective silver halide grain growth-modifying agent. A process for modifying the grain growth of silver halide is also described. |

DETAILED DESCRIPTION What is claimed is: 1. A photographic silver halide emulsion comprising a 1,1,3,3-tetra-substituted urea compound having the structural formula: ##STR6## wherein X is a middle chalcogen atom; each of R. sub. 1, R. sub. 2, R. sub. 3 and R. sub. 4, independently, can represent an alkylene, cycloalkylene, alkarylene, aralkylene or heterocyclic arylene group, or taken together with the nitrogen atom to which they are attached, R. sub. 1 and R. sub. 2 or R. sub. 3 and R. sub. 4 complete a 5 to 7 member heterocyclic ring; and each of A. sub. 1, A. sub. 2, A. sub. 3 and A. sub. 4, independently, is hydrogen or represents a radical comprising an acidic group; with the proviso that at least one of A. sub. 1 R. sub. 1 to A. sub. 4 R. sub. 4 contains an acidic group bonded to a urea nitrogen atom through a chain comprising at least 4 atoms wherein the acidic group has a dissociation constant pKa smaller than about 7 said urea compound being present in an amount of from about 10. sup. -6 to about 10. sup. -1 mol thereof per mol of silver halide. 2. The photographic emulsion of claim 1 wherein X is sulfur. 3. The photographic emulsion of claim 1 wherein the acidic group comprises the OH portion of an oxygen acid which is carboxylic, sulfinic, sulfonic or hydroxamic group. 4. The photographic emulsion of claim 3 wherein said acidic group is carboxylic acid or an inorganic or organic salt thereof. 5. The photographic emulsion of claim 1 wherein the compound is present in an amount of from about 10. sup. -4 to about 10. sup. -2 mol thereof per mol of silver halide. 6. The photographic emulsion of claim 1 wherein the compound is: ##STR7## 7. The photographic emulsion of claim 1 wherein the compound is: ##STR8## 8. The photographic emulsion of claim 1 wherein the compound is: ##STR9## 9. The photographic emulsion of claim 1 wherin the compound is: ##STR10## 10.
